[发明专利]基于上下文信息的对话系统在审
申请号: | 202010831019.6 | 申请日: | 2020-08-18 |
公开(公告)号: | CN112528678A | 公开(公告)日: | 2021-03-19 |
发明(设计)人: | 李善焕;S·米斯拉 | 申请(专利权)人: | 国际商业机器公司 |
主分类号: | G06F40/35 | 分类号: | G06F40/35;G06N3/08;G06N7/00;G06N20/00 |
代理公司: | 北京市中咨律师事务所 11247 | 代理人: | 于静;杨晓光 |
地址: | 美国*** | 国省代码: | 暂无信息 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 基于 上下文 信息 对话 系统 | ||
本发明涉及一种基于上下文信息的对话系统。提供了促进基于上下文信息的对话系统的技术。在一个示例中,一种系统包括上下文信息组件和对话路由组件。上下文信息组件基于与由与用户身份相关联的计算设备接收的通信信息有关的陈述来确定与用户身份相关联的上下文信息。对话路由组件基于上下文信息为对话系统生成路径遍历,以促进由对话系统生成对陈述的响应。
技术领域
本公开涉及对话系统,更具体地,涉及与对话系统有关的人工智能。
背景技术
对话系统(例如,对话计算系统、聊天系统、数字助理等)是可以采用人工智能和/或自然语言处理来促进人机交互的计算机系统。由于管理不同任务的复杂性,对话系统通常处理单个任务。此外,对话系统通常依赖于提供给对话系统的用户陈述输入和/或用户陈述输入的意图来生成对提供给对话系统的问题的响应。在一个示例中,Guo等人的美国专利公开US2018/0082184公开了“问题确定模块302可以被配置为分析问题并确定问题类型。分析问题可能是指推导该问题的语义(问题实际上是在问什么)。问题确定模块302可以被配置为通过导出在问题中嵌入多少部分或含义来分析问题。可以通过问题-答案匹配来学习问题的特征。”但是,依赖于提供给对话系统的用户陈述输入和/或用户陈述输入的意图来生成响应,可能例如导致用户输入被路由到对话系统的错误技能。
发明内容
以下给出了概述,以提供对本发明的一个或多个实施例的基本理解。该概述并非旨在标识关键或重要元素,也不旨在描绘特定实施例的任何范围或权利要求的任何范围。其唯一目的是以简化的形式提出概念,作为稍后提出的更详细描述的序言。在本文描述的一个或多个实施例中,描述了有助于基于上下文信息的对话系统的设备、系统、计算机实现的方法、装置和/或计算机程序产品。
根据一个实施例,系统可以包括上下文信息和对话组件。上下文信息组件可以基于与由与用户身份相关联的计算设备接收的通信信息有关的陈述来确定与用户身份相关联的上下文信息。对话路由组件可以基于上下文信息为对话系统生成路径遍历,以促进由对话系统生成对陈述的响应。与常规对话系统技术相比,该系统可以提供各种优点。在某些实施例中,系统可以提供将对话系统的输入路由到对话系统的相应技能的改进的性能。在一个实施例中,对话路由组件可以基于上下文信息生成与对话系统的路径遍历相关联的机器学习模型。在另一个实施例中,对话路由组件可以基于上下文信息将与陈述相关联的信息路由到对话系统的技能。在又一个实施例中,上下文信息组件可以基于陈述来确定意图信息。在某些实施例中,对话路由组件可以基于上下文信息和意图信息来生成对话系统的路径遍历。在又一个实施例中,上下文信息组件可以基于指示与计算设备相关联的位置的位置数据来确定上下文信息。在又一个实施例中,上下文信息组件可以基于存储在计算设备中的用户简档数据来确定上下文信息。在又一个实施例中,上下文信息组件可以确定陈述的第一分类和上下文信息的第二分类。在某些实施例中,系统可以包括通信组件。在一个实施例中,通信组件可以基于计算设备接收到的音频数据来获得陈述。在另一个实施例中,通信组件可以基于计算设备接收到的文本数据来获得陈述。在某些实施例中,对话路由组件可以生成对话系统的路径遍历,以改善对话系统的性能。
根据另一个实施例,提供了一种计算机实现的方法。该计算机实现的方法可以包括:由与处理器可操作地耦合的系统基于与由与用户身份相关联的计算设备接收的通信信息有关的陈述来确定与用户身份相关联的上下文信息。该计算机实现的方法还可以包括:由系统基于上下文信息为对话系统生成路径遍历,以促进由对话系统生成对陈述的响应。与常规对话系统技术相比,该方法可以提供各种优点。在某些实施例中,该方法可以提供将对话系统的输入路由到对话系统的相应技能的改进的性能。在一个实施例中,计算机实现的方法可以包括由系统基于上下文信息生成与对话系统的路径遍历相关联的机器学习模型。在另一个实施例中,计算机实现的方法可以包括由系统基于上下文信息将与陈述相关联的信息路由到对话系统的技能。在又一个实施例中,计算机实现的方法可以包括由系统基于由计算设备接收的音频数据或由计算设备接收的文本数据来获得陈述。在某些实施例中,生成路径遍历可以包括改善对话系统的性能。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于国际商业机器公司,未经国际商业机器公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202010831019.6/2.html,转载请声明来源钻瓜专利网。
- 上一篇:用于自主和半自主车辆的路径规划
- 下一篇:离心泵和泵壳
- 信息记录介质、信息记录方法、信息记录设备、信息再现方法和信息再现设备
- 信息记录装置、信息记录方法、信息记录介质、信息复制装置和信息复制方法
- 信息记录装置、信息再现装置、信息记录方法、信息再现方法、信息记录程序、信息再现程序、以及信息记录介质
- 信息记录装置、信息再现装置、信息记录方法、信息再现方法、信息记录程序、信息再现程序、以及信息记录介质
- 信息记录设备、信息重放设备、信息记录方法、信息重放方法、以及信息记录介质
- 信息存储介质、信息记录方法、信息重放方法、信息记录设备、以及信息重放设备
- 信息存储介质、信息记录方法、信息回放方法、信息记录设备和信息回放设备
- 信息记录介质、信息记录方法、信息记录装置、信息再现方法和信息再现装置
- 信息终端,信息终端的信息呈现方法和信息呈现程序
- 信息创建、信息发送方法及信息创建、信息发送装置